WebDec 8, 2024 · Charles Ray: Archangel, 2024. In 1962 the artist Robert Morris made a sculpture called I-Box. It was about the size of a large book, with a capital “I” incised into the front surface and hinged like a cupboard door. When opened, the I-shaped portal revealed a black-and-white photograph of the artist facing the viewer wearing only a sly grin. WebX-ray fluorescence analysis instruments can be largely categorized into wavelength-dispersive X-ray spectroscopy (WDX) and energy-dispersive X-ray spectroscopy (EDX). (See Figure 2.) WDX disperses the fluorescent X-rays generated in a sample using an analyzing crystal and a goniometer, resulting in the instrument being large in size.
WebAug 28, 2024 · Powder X-Ray diffraction (XRD) was developed in 1916 by Debye (Figure 7.3.12) and Scherrer (Figure 7.3.13) as a technique that could be applied where traditional single-crystal diffraction cannot be performed. This includes cases where the sample cannot be prepared as a single crystal of sufficient size and quality.
